Understanding Stoma Care

What is a Stoma?

A stoma is an operatively produced opening that attaches an interior body organ to the outdoors. It's frequently essential following surgical treatments including the intestinal tracts or bladder due to problems like cancer or inflammatory bowel diseases.

What is Ostomy Care?

Ostomy treatment entails maintaining hygiene and preventing issues connected with stomas. Correct ostomy care can substantially improve convenience and quality of life for individuals living with stomas.

Stoma Care Training for Carers

Carers play a vital function in taking care of ostomy care efficiently. This training addresses:

Types of Stomas: Understanding colostomies, ileostomies, and urostomies. Equipment Usage: Experience with bags and skin barriers. Routine Checks: Exactly how to monitor stoma result and skin integrity. Recognizing Complications: Determining signs of infection or leakage early on.
